Karl E. Mundt Speech Contest

Dakota State University held the annual Karl E. Mundt Speech contest on campus April 21. The contest is hosted by the College of Arts and Sciences and sponsored by the Karl E. Mundt Foundation and the Madison Area Arts Council.

DSU students are invited to participate and speeches are judged by faculty and staff of the university. Cash prizes donated by the Mundt Foundation and the Madison Area Arts Council were awarded to the top three places in each category.

The results in the Informative Speaking category were as follows: 1st Nicole Hoiten; 2nd Noah Sanderson; 3rd Brian Siemonsma; 4th, Noelle Nielsen; 5th, Nicole Lingemann; and 6th, Jennifer Sixta. 

Results in the Persuasive category were as follows: 1st Brett Kearin; 2nd Nicole Hoiten; 3rd Jodi Neugebauer; 4th Noelle Nielsen; 5th Noah Sanderson; and 6th Ashley Spindler.
